String festival channels positive energy
“Positive Energy With Strings Attached” is the catchphrase of Court Street Chamber Orchestra’s National String Festival. The festival began in 2001 as a means of encouraging young string instrumentalists to showcase their talents and reward their efforts in the years that there was no National Biennual Music Festival.
The intent: to create an event where the players could meet and encourage each other. Court Street Chamber Orchestra is a non-profit organisation that has been assisting the nation’s youth and adults in learning music since 1992. On many occasions the orchestra sponsors music lessons for those who can’t afford them, assisting in Royal School of Music/Trinity Guildhall fees, as well as partial assistance for some of our alumni to study abroad.
On April 3 and 4, T&T’s string instrumentalists are invited to demonstrate their talent and skill in a friendly competition for trophies and cash prizes, according to age divisions and instrument categories. Winners will perform in the Grand Concert on April 6, at The National Academy of Performing Arts (NAPA), South Campus, San Fernando.
Featured this year as adjudicators and performers, are the world-class String Faculty of UTT, Jonathan Storer (concertmaster); Eleanor Rya (violin); Simon Brown (viola); Caitlyn Kamminga (double bass)—and special guest cellist from Washington DC, Tobias Werner.
In addition, a New American school of string-playing will be debuted from the O’Connor Method, an inspiring selection will be performed by a collaboration of players from Court Street Chamber Orchestra, UTT, and gifted T&T youth.
